The India Bioconjugation Market was valued at $47.3 Million in 2024 and projected to reach to $100.2 Million by 2029, representing a compound annual growth rate of CAGR 16.2%. India's bioconjugation market is poised for significant expansion, driven by the country's thriving pharmaceutical and biotechnology sectors increasingly adopting advanced conjugation technologies.

INDIA: BIOCONJUGATION PRODUCTS MARKET, BY END USER, 2022–2029

Segment20222023202420252026202720282029CAGR (%)
ACADEMIC & RESEARCH INSTITUTES12.412.914.115.717.720.423.928.615.2
CROS & CMOS14.515.316.91921.725.329.936.316.5
HOSPITALS AND CLINICAL/DIAGNOSTIC LABORATORIES10.711.11213.314.91719.823.614.4
PHARMACEUTICAL & BIOTECHNOLOGY COMPANIES31.432.836.140.446.153.362.975.916
TOTAL68.97279.188.3100.4116136.5164.315.7

INDIA: BIOCONJUGATION SERVICES MARKET, BY END USER, 2022–2029

Segment20222023202420252026202720282029CAGR (%)
ACADEMIC & RESEARCH INSTITUTES14.216.819.723.42833.84150.120.5
HOSPITALS AND CLINICAL/DIAGNOSTIC LABORATORIES7.28.49.711.413.51619.223.219
PHARMACEUTICAL & BIOTECHNOLOGY COMPANIES29.735.341.649.559.872.488.2108.221.1
TOTAL51.160.570.984.3101.3122.3148.5181.520.7

Market Definition

Bioconjugation refers to the chemical or biological process of forming a stable covalent bond between two molecules, typically involving a biomolecule (such as a protein, antibody, nucleic acid, or peptide) and another molecule, which could be a drug, imaging agent, polymer, or another biomolecule_ The purpose of bioconjugation is to combine the properties of the two molecules, creating a single functional entity with enhanced or novel capabilities.

The report presents the market size for bioconjugation services and products that can be utilized throughout the bioconjugation process, from preparation to analysis. The key segments of the market include products such as consumables, & instruments, along with services for bioconjugation.
